Travel Tour Expo at SMX

Mary Grace Padin - The Philippine Star

MANILA, Philippines - More than 100,000 travelers are expected to flock the booths during this year’s 24th Travel Tour Expo (TTE) on Feb. 10 to 12 at the SMX Convention Center in Pasay City to take advantage of big discounts in domestic and international travel fares and tour packages.

“We expect more deals to come out as we have more airlines participating, and we also expect more visitors to come because it’s really the most awaited expo and as of now a lot of people are already inquiring,” Philippine Travel Agencies Association  (PTAA) president Maria Michelle Reyes-Victoria said.

Considered the largest travel and tourism event in the country, PTAA’s TTE is seen to give a boost to the Philippine tourism industry.

Tourism Undersecretary Benito Bengzon said travel fairs, such as the TTE, stimulates the growth of travel suppliers in the value chain.

“With Filipinos going abroad, they become our tourism ambassadors,” Bengzon said.

Victoria, for her part, said TTE has placed a spotlight on the Philippines as a “favored and emerging tourism destination.”

According to Victoria, a total of 311 exhibitors, which include airlines, travel agencies, hotels and resorts, theme parks,  and national tourism organizations will be participating in this year’s expo, as compared to 331 last year.

She said the participants would be occupying larger booth spaces to accommodate more customers.
